A Legacy of Substantial Wealth
Reports indicate that Dharmendra's total assets are estimated to be between 335 to 450 crore rupees. This vast sum reflects decades of a highly successful acting career combined with strategic business ventures and smart investments across various sectors. His ability to diversify his earnings, moving beyond just film remuneration into areas like hospitality and real estate, played a crucial role in accumulating such a significant fortune. This estimated net worth firmly places him among the wealthiest personalities in the Indian entertainment industry, highlighting his foresight and business intelligence. Strategic Diversification Through Property Investments
Beyond his iconic Lonavala farmhouse, Dharmendra had made several other significant and strategic investments in real estate, demonstrating a keen understanding of property as a long-term asset. He owned substantial property in Maharashtra, which alone was valued at 17 crore rupees, further solidifying his presence in the state's lucrative real estate market. This investment indicates a calculated move to hold assets in a region known for its appreciating property values. Also, his portfolio included investments in both agricultural and non-agricultural land, with holdings exceeding 88 lakh rupees and 52 lakh rupees respectively. These diverse land investments highlight his strategy of spreading his assets across different types of properties, ensuring a solid and growing portfolio that could withstand market fluctuations and provide steady returns. Entrepreneurial Ventures: From Dhaba to Resort Development
Dharmendra wasn't merely an actor but a visionary entrepreneur who successfully ventured into the hospitality sector. He famously launched the "Garam Dharam Dhaba" chain of restaurants, which has since grown into a highly recognized and successful brand across various locations. The success of this venture demonstrated his innate understanding of the hospitality industry and his ability to connect with the masses through a relatable and appealing concept, leveraging his popular image, while following the success of "Garam Dharam Dhaba," he further expanded his footprint in the food and beverage sector by opening another themed restaurant named "He-Man" on the bustling Karnal Highway.
These restaurant ventures are reported to have Importantly boosted his wealth and income, proving his prowess as a businessman capable of translating his brand appeal into commercial success. Also, an Economic Times report indicated that Dharmendra had entered into a strategic partnership with a restaurant company to develop an ambitious resort project. This project involved constructing 30 cottages on a 12-acre plot situated conveniently close to his beloved Lonavala farmhouse. This initiative showcased his continuous drive to innovate and expand his business interests, intelligently blending his personal retreat with a commercial enterprise designed to attract tourists and provide a unique experience.
